Project name: Methanobrevibacter smithii ATCC 35061
Description: RNA-sequencing is a powerful tool for exploring expression profiles of microbial species that does not require the production of a custom genechip.We used microarrays to compare our quantitative RNA-sequencing method to the standard expression quantification methodsOverall design: Methanobrevibacter smithii PS cultures were grown to stationary phase under 80% hydrogen, 20% CO2, with varying amounts of formate. RNA was extracted and purified, then divided into two aliquots per sample. One aliquot was prepared for hybridization on Affymetrix gene chips, the other was prepared for microbial RNA-sequencing.
